What location were they heard in? That could help narrow it down.
You will probably have to find the inputs yourself.
They should all be between 162.0375-166.4875. See https://wiki.radioreference.com/index.php/Federal_VHF/UHF_Channel_Plans

The only one I can possibly identify is if 172.0625 NAC 301 is a CBP/ICE repeater then it might be DNET-202 and the input would be 165.2375 NAC 325.
